This course examines both individual human needs and society's legal response to those needs as they impact the design of interior space and furnishings. Human factors include anthropometrics and ergonomics; social factors include governmental laws, codes, zoning, standards and regulations. Areas of overlap include universal accessibility guidelines, ADAAG (Americans With Disability Act Guidelines), life safety and fire codes.
